গ্রেডলে জেসিটারের ভাণ্ডারের অন্তর্ভুক্ত কী?


141

গ্রেডল ১. From থেকে নতুন পাবলিক রিপোজিটরি জেসেন্টার রয়েছে।

repositories {  
   jcenter()  
}

সুতরাং আমি জানতে চাই যে মাভেন সেন্ট্রাল থেকে সমস্ত জারগুলি এই রেপোর অংশ? আর যদি না হয় তবে জেসেন্টার রেপো কী থেকে গঠিত? এবং জেনসেটর কি ডাউনটাইম হিসাবে ম্যাভেন সেন্ট্রাল থেকে আরও নির্ভরযোগ্য?


উত্তর:


126

jcenter()অনুরূপ mavenCentral()। আরও তথ্যের জন্য https://bintray.com/bintray/jcenter এ দেখুন । জেসেন্টার ছেলেরা দাবি করেছে যে মাভেন সেন্ট্রালের চেয়ে তাদের আরও ভাল পারফরম্যান্স রয়েছে।


33
এখন জেসেন্টারে ম্যাভেন-শিফারফায়ার-প্লাগইনের কোনও 1.18.1 সংস্করণ নেই, তবে মাভেনসেন্ট্রালে এই সংস্করণটি উপস্থাপন করা হয়েছে। সুতরাং এটি ম্যাভেনসেন্ট্রালের খাঁটি সুপারসেট নয় ()
জেলিয়ান

আরেকটি উদাহরণ হ'ল অ্যাপেনজিন-এপি -১.০- এসডিকে : মাভেনসেন্ট্রালে ভি ১.৯.২২ রয়েছে, তবে জেনেটারে কেবল ভি ১.৯.১77 রয়েছে।
নেক্সা

9
মতে ডক jcenter() পয়েন্ট jcenter.bintray.com এবং mavenCentral()করতে repo1.maven.org/maven2
real_paul

8
@ জেলিয়ান, যতদূর আমি জানি তারা অলস এবং স্বচ্ছ। সুতরাং যদিও এটি এটি দেখায় না যে তাদের কাছে ফাইল রয়েছে, আপনি এটি উল্লেখ করতে পারেন এবং এটি অন্য কোনও উত্স থেকে অলস-ফাইলটি আনার পরে এটি আপনাকে সঠিকভাবে পরিবেশন করবে ।
TWiStErRob

আমার বিল্ডস্ক্রিপ্টে আমার একটি ক্লাসপথ রয়েছে: org.javafxport: jfxmobile-پلিন: 1.3.8 - এর আগে বলা হয় jcenter()। আমি যখন org.javafxports গুগল: jfxmobile-প্লাগইন: 1.3.8 আমি আসা bitbucket.org/javafxports/javafxmobile-plugin । এর অর্থ জেনেটর সমান বাটবুকিট!
লেওলো

21

Https://bintray.com/bintray/jcenter এ উল্লিখিত :

জে সেন্টার হ'ল সেই জায়গা যা ম্যাভেন, গ্রেডল, আইভী, এসবিটি ইত্যাদি ব্যবহারের জন্য জনপ্রিয় অ্যাপাচি মাভেন প্যাকেজগুলি সন্ধান এবং ভাগ করে নেওয়ার মতো জায়গা যা নিদর্শনগুলির সর্বাধিক বিস্তৃত সংগ্রহের জন্য, আপনার মেভেনকে এখানে নির্দেশ করুন: http://jcenter.bintray.com বিতরণ করতে চান আপনার নিজের প্যাকেজগুলি জেসেন্টারের মাধ্যমে? "আমার প্যাকেজ অন্তর্ভুক্ত করুন" বোতামটি ক্লিক করে আপনি আপনার প্যাকেজটি লিঙ্ক করতে পারেন। এবং যদি আপনি উত্তরাধিকার সূত্রে থাকেন তবে আপনি নিজের প্যাকেজগুলি সরাসরি মাভেন সেন্ট্রালে সিঙ্ক্রোনাইজ করতে পারেন।

এছাড়াও আমি https://www.jfrog.com/ জ্ঞান- base /why-should- i-use- jcenter- over-maven- central/ এ একটি ভাল তুলনা খুঁজে পাই (দুর্ভাগ্যক্রমে লিঙ্কটি মারা গেছে তবে কিছু দরকারী ইঙ্গিত এখানে রয়েছে)

জেন্টার হ'ল প্রকাশিত সংগ্রহস্থল বিন্টরে যা ওপেন সোর্স লাইব্রেরি প্রকাশকদের জন্য বিনামূল্যে মুক্ত hos মাভেন সেন্ট্রাল জুসেন্টার ব্যবহার করার অনেকগুলি ভাল কারণ রয়েছে। এখানে কিছু প্রধানকে দেওয়া হল:

  1. জেন্টার সিডিএন এর মাধ্যমে লাইব্রেরি সরবরাহ করে যার অর্থ সিআই এবং বিকাশকারী বিল্ডগুলির উন্নতি।
  2. জেন্টার পৃথিবীর বৃহত্তম জাভা রিপোজিটরি। এর অর্থ হ'ল মাভেন সেন্ট্রালে যা কিছু পাওয়া যায় সেগুলিও জেন্সটারে উপলভ্য।
  3. বিন্ট্রেতে আপনার নিজের লাইব্রেরিটি আপলোড করা অবিশ্বাস্যরকম সহজ। মাভেন সেন্ট্রালে আপনাকে যা করতে হবে সেগুলিতে সাইন ইন করার বা কোনও জটিল কাজ করার দরকার নেই।
  4. বন্ধুত্বপূর্ণ-ইউআই আপনি যদি আপনার লাইব্রেরিটি ম্যাভেন সেন্ট্রালে আপলোড করতে চান তবে আপনি বিন্ট্রে সাইটে একক ক্লিক করে সহজেই এটি করতে পারেন।

এই লিঙ্কটি মারা গেছে: jfrog.com/ জ্ঞান- বেস / এবং এটি আপডেট করার জন্য এটি স্থানান্তরিত করা হয়েছে এমন আমি কোথাও পাইনি
ক্রিস আর

1
লিঙ্কটি অনুসন্ধান করার দরকার নেই (যেমন আমি কেবল ওয়েবব্যাক মেশিনে করেছি) কারণ আলিরেজা লিঙ্কযুক্ত পৃষ্ঠাটি থেকে তার উত্তরে পাঠ্যটি অনুলিপি করেছেন।
জেএল_এসও

10

ম্যাভেন সেন্ট্রাল এবং জেসেন্টার বেশিরভাগ সমান, ব্যবহারকারীর দৃষ্টিকোণ থেকে from

২ টি বড় রেপো হওয়ার কারণটি হ'ল মাভেন সেন্ট্রাল সোনাতাইপ দ্বারা সমর্থিত, মাভেনের পিছনে সংস্থা এবং বিশেষত নেক্সাসের পিছনে, তারা একটি প্রতিষ্ঠানের মাভেন সংগ্রহশালা যা তারা উদ্যোগে বিক্রি করে।

জেএসেন্টার জেফ্রোগের সহায়তায়, নেফাসের প্রতিদ্বন্দ্বী শিল্পী কারখানার পিছনে সংস্থা। আমি যা মনে করি তা থেকে জেএফগ্রাও কিছুটা সময়ের জন্য গ্র্যাডেলকে সমর্থন করেছিল, মাভেনের প্রতিযোগী হিসাবে।

সুতরাং শেষ পর্যন্ত এটি প্রতিযোগী সংস্থাগুলি সম্পর্কে গ্রাহকদের তাদের উচ্চ স্তরের এন্টারপ্রাইজ অফারগুলিতে আকৃষ্ট করার জন্য বিনামূল্যে পরিষেবা প্রদানের বিষয়ে।

আপনি যদি সেগুলির মধ্যে একটির ব্যবহারের খুব নির্দিষ্ট কারণ না পান তবে আপনি মূলত একটি মুদ্রা বেছে নিতে পারেন।


1

jCenter () নিদর্শন যে উপস্থিত না থাকার রয়েছে mavenCentral () উদাহরণস্বরূপcom/bmuschko/gradle-cargo-plugin/2.2.3/gradle-cargo-plugin-2.2.3.jar

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.